一、区块链浏览器的基本概念
区块链浏览器是一种用于查看和查询区块链上数据的工具。它允许用户通过图形界面或API接口访问区块链网络中的各种信息,如交易记录、区块信息、地址余额等。区块链浏览器的主要功能是提供一个透明、可追溯的视图,帮助用户理解和分析区块链上的活动。
1.1 区块链浏览器的核心功能
- 数据可视化:将复杂的区块链数据以易于理解的方式呈现给用户。
- 实时更新:实时同步区块链网络的很新数据,确保信息的及时性。
- 多链支持:支持多种区块链网络,如比特币、以太坊等。
1.2 区块链浏览器的重要性
- 透明度:区块链浏览器使得所有交易和区块信息公开透明,增强了信任。
- 可追溯性:用户可以通过区块链浏览器追溯每一笔交易的来源和去向。
- 数据分析:为企业和开发者提供数据支持,帮助他们进行决策和优化。
二、交易查询与验证
交易查询与验证是区块链浏览器的核心功能之一。用户可以通过输入交易哈希(Transaction Hash)来查询特定交易的详细信息,包括交易金额、发送方和接收方地址、交易时间等。
2.1 交易查询
- 交易哈希:每个交易都有一个先进的哈希值,用户可以通过输入哈希值查询交易详情。
- 交易状态:显示交易是否已被确认,以及确认的次数。
2.2 交易验证
- 双重验证:通过区块链浏览器,用户可以验证交易的真实性和完整性。
- 防篡改:区块链的不可篡改性确保了交易记录的真实性。
2.3 实际应用案例
- 供应链管理:企业可以通过区块链浏览器验证供应链中的每一笔交易,确保数据的真实性和透明度。
- 金融服务:银行和金融机构可以使用区块链浏览器验证跨境支付交易,减少欺诈风险。
三、区块信息浏览
区块信息浏览功能允许用户查看区块链网络中的每一个区块的详细信息,包括区块高度、区块哈希、时间戳、交易数量等。
3.1 区块信息
- 区块高度:表示区块在区块链中的位置,从创世区块开始计数。
- 区块哈希:每个区块都有一个先进的哈希值,用于标识该区块。
- 时间戳:记录区块生成的时间。
3.2 区块内容
- 交易列表:显示该区块中包含的所有交易。
- 矿工奖励:显示该区块的矿工获得的奖励。
3.3 实际应用案例
- 区块链开发:开发者可以通过区块信息浏览功能分析区块链的结构和性能,优化开发流程。
- 审计与合规:审计机构可以通过区块信息浏览功能进行区块链数据的审计,确保合规性。
四、地址及余额查询
地址及余额查询功能允许用户通过输入区块链地址来查询该地址的余额和交易历史。
4.1 地址查询
- 地址类型:包括普通地址、合约地址等。
- 交易历史:显示该地址的所有交易记录。
4.2 余额查询
- 实时余额:显示该地址的当前余额。
- 余额变化:显示该地址的余额变化历史。
4.3 实际应用案例
- 资产管理:企业可以通过地址及余额查询功能管理其区块链资产,确保资产安全。
- 用户验证:通过查询地址余额,企业可以验证用户的资产状况,进行风险评估。
五、智能合约交互
智能合约交互功能允许用户通过区块链浏览器与智能合约进行交互,包括查看合约代码、调用合约函数等。
5.1 智能合约查询
- 合约地址:每个智能合约都有一个先进的地址。
- 合约代码:显示智能合约的源代码。
5.2 合约调用
- 函数调用:用户可以通过区块链浏览器调用智能合约的函数,执行特定操作。
- 交易记录:显示智能合约的所有交易记录。
5.3 实际应用案例
- 去中心化应用(DApp):开发者可以通过智能合约交互功能测试和优化DApp的性能。
- 自动化流程:企业可以通过智能合约实现自动化流程,如自动支付、自动结算等。
六、网络状态监控
网络状态监控功能允许用户实时监控区块链网络的状态,包括节点数量、交易吞吐量、网络延迟等。
6.1 网络状态
- 节点数量:显示当前区块链网络中的节点数量。
- 交易吞吐量:显示区块链网络的交易处理能力。
6.2 网络性能
- 网络延迟:显示区块链网络的延迟情况。
- 区块生成时间:显示区块生成的平均时间。
6.3 实际应用案例
- 网络优化:开发者可以通过网络状态监控功能优化区块链网络的性能。
- 故障排查:企业可以通过网络状态监控功能及时发现和解决网络故障,确保业务连续性。
总结
区块链浏览器作为区块链生态系统中不可或缺的工具,提供了丰富的功能,帮助用户查询、验证和分析区块链数据。通过交易查询与验证、区块信息浏览、地址及余额查询、智能合约交互和网络状态监控等功能,用户可以更好地理解和利用区块链技术。在实际应用中,区块链浏览器不仅提高了数据的透明度和可追溯性,还为企业和开发者提供了强大的数据支持,推动了区块链技术的广泛应用和发展。
原创文章,作者:IT_admin,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/216450